Hello all,
I am finishing up an Atwater Kent model 717 tombstone that is missing the speaker plug. A standard 4 pin tube base will not work as the pins are too far apart. Anyone have a solution for a replacement?

Hi Jon: For a temporary solution you can solder individual pins on the speaker leads and plug each wire in seperately.You can use the pins from a bad order four pin tube
